Wes Griffith (former member of Grandview, the Commercials, Daytime Dilemma, and other bands) & Josh Blackway (former guitarist of the Huntingtons, Main Line Riders, Fred & the Savages, and other bands) created the Black Fins at Josh's house in Salisbury, MD, in April of 2007.
Wes & Josh are big fans of 50's/60's oldies, surf rock and classic rock & roll.
The first goal was to record a new version of the classic Del Shannon song "Runaway". After hurdling this challenging song, they took on another classic by Tommy James & The Shondells, "I Think We're Alone Now".
Both sing and play guitar. Wes does most of the singing. Josh does most of the guitars.
